Adam FITAS – On Three Books From the Young Józef Mackiewicz’s Bookshelf

The author discusses books that—to a large extent—formed the young Józef Mackiewicz as a thinker and writer. In his childhood, Mackiewicz was a passionate ‘natural scientist,’ and books by Alfred Brehm (in particular his Life of Animals), as well as those of by Modest Bogdanov, not only were his guidebooks in the world of nature, but provided for him the way of approaching the world as such, of conceiving it and spotting unnatural situations, also those manipulated and false. The author of the article aims at demonstrating the relation between the passions of the young Mackiewicz and the shaping of his outlook upon the world.
